It's been 62 years since a Canadian lifted the trophy at the RBC Canadian Open. Perhaps it'll take an amateur to break the streak.

Playing together during the first round at Glen Abbey, both Jared du Toit and Garrett Rank made surprising moves onto the early leaderboard in Ontario.

Du Toit, a rising senior at Arizona State, opened with birdies on four of his first six holes. While he cooled in the middle of his round, du Toit authored a highlight when he holed his approach from a fairway bunker for eagle on No. 17.
